gpt4 book ai didi

ios - Eclipse 建模框架和 XPAND - 如何创建 iOS 元模型?

转载 作者:行者123 更新时间:2023-11-29 10:58:41 24 4
gpt4 key购买 nike

我想使用 Eclipse 建模框架 (EMF) 和 XPAND 定义模型驱动方法。因此,我想用 Ecore 定义平台特定的元模型 (PSM),并为 iOS 平台编写代码生成的 XPAND 模板。

我的问题是:

是否可以在 EMF 中为 iOS 平台定义这样一个 PSM?因为 iOS 或其他平台有自己的数据类型。我还可以使用 EDataType 定义数据类型,但它们必须与 Java 数据类型相关吗?

最佳答案

最好在Eclipse eclipse.tools.emf 论坛上问...

Ecore 本身与 Java 紧密绑定(bind),因此已经是 EMF 基于 Java 的核心运行时的 PSM。您最好为 iOS 定义您自己的类似 Ecore 的模型(使用 Ecore 定义该模型,就像使用 Ecore 定义自身和其他模型(如 UML2 和 XSD)一样)。而且你也可能比使用旧的 Xpand 技术更好地使用新的基于 Xtext 的 Xtend 语言,因为它有更好的支持和更好的工具,例如,与 JDT 和 JDT 的调试器集成,这样你就可以无缝地调试你的 Xtend 模板源在你的普通调试器。

关于ios - Eclipse 建模框架和 XPAND - 如何创建 iOS 元模型?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17085426/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com